Château Bel Air Gloria
Château Bel Air Gloria sits in Haut-Médoc, the heart of Bordeaux's Left Bank, where gravelly soils and a maritime climate shape wines of structure and depth. The estate's Haut-Médoc blend draws on four classic varieties—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Petit Verdot, and Cabernet Franc—in proportions that reflect the terroir's demands. Cabernet Sauvignon and Petit Verdot provide the backbone; Merlot adds mid-palate weight; Cabernet Franc contributes aromatic complexity. Wine Enthusiast and Decanter have both assessed the wine, recognizing its balance and aging potential. The result is a wine rooted in Haut-Médoc tradition: structured, mineral-edged, built for the cellar.
